In today’s fast-paced digital world, the demand for effective and efficient ways to deliver education and training has never been greater This is where Learning Management Systems (LMS) come into play A Learning Management System is a software application that enables the management, delivery, and tracking of educational content In the UK, the adoption of LMS has become increasingly prevalent due to its numerous benefits for educational institutions, businesses, and organizations.
One of the key advantages of using a Learning Management System in the UK is the ability to provide a centralized platform for all learning materials and resources This means that students, employees, and learners can access course materials, assignments, quizzes, and other educational content from one place, eliminating the need for physical handouts or multiple platforms With the shift to remote and hybrid learning models in the wake of the COVID-19 pandemic, having a centralized platform for learning has become essential for ensuring continuity in education.
Another benefit of using a Learning Management System in the UK is the ability to track progress and monitor performance LMS software allows instructors and administrators to track student or employee progress through online assessments, quizzes, and assignments This data can help identify areas where students may be struggling and provide personalized feedback and support Additionally, LMS platforms often come with reporting tools that can generate insights into learner engagement and participation, helping educators make informed decisions about course content and delivery.

Furthermore, Learning Management Systems can help organizations in the UK stay compliant with industry regulations and standards Many LMS platforms come equipped with features that enable administrators to create and track compliance training courses, ensuring that employees receive the necessary training to meet regulatory requirements This can be particularly valuable for industries such as healthcare, finance, and manufacturing, where adherence to compliance standards is critical.
In addition to providing a centralized platform for learning materials and tracking progress, Learning Management Systems in the UK offer benefits in terms of scalability and customization LMS software can be tailored to meet the specific needs of different educational institutions, businesses, and organizations, allowing for a personalized learning experience Whether it’s adding custom branding, integrating third-party applications, or creating tailored courses, LMS platforms offer flexibility and adaptability to suit individual requirements.
